MFA Spokesman's Comments on Minister Jayakumar

In response to media queries, the MFA Spokesman said that Minister Jayakumar is remaining in London for further medical tests. He continues to have a slight fever but he is otherwise in good shape.

Minister Jayakumar will skip the ASEAN-Japan Commemorative Summit in Tokyo, which he was scheduled to attend together with Prime Minister Goh Chok Tong from 10 to 12 December 2003. He is expected to return to Singapore within a few days. Second Minister for Foreign Affairs Lee Yock Suan will attend the meeting in Tokyo instead.
